With 156 units built between 1998 and 2004, the X-362 Sport is one of the most successful performance cruising yachts from the Danish boatbuilder. MANUFACTURER'S COMMENTS:

In 1993 the ultimate racer was born. The X-362 was an exceptionally stiff yacht and appealed to more conservative sailors who demanded high levels of comfort.

Based on the success of the original X-362, a Sports version was added in 1998. She had a deeper, lighter keel, fractional rig, enlarged wheel and mahogany interior.

In the design process of the X-362, the attention to winning potential was of secondary priority. The first priority was the demand for a timeless, comfortable, safe and easily handled yet perfect sailing 36-footer with adequate room and facility for a "normal family" - but of course by giving her the "standard" X-Yachts attention to smooth and fast sailing, enabling her to also please the performance-orientated sailor.

The new Sports design with more sail area made a big enough difference to beat the little sister X-332 which won more regattas than any earlier X-Yachts, including the IMS European Championship - suddenly it was the X-362 Sport which in 1999 was unbeatable, winning in both IMS (European IMS C/R winner) and IRC. 2000 results including UK IRC Nationals, Cord Cork Week - and Frühjahrswoche in Germany.
